Output e4c916dfc90b49157bcbf032d844487fa445fa367dabfae0a5efcb99f8bfde13:3

value
103426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d55e5271babf162b54a598bef92039ce61bce8 OP_EQUAL
address
3DAMzd2qH111uWqumqTTnvTWYiMu6zsfkg
transaction
e4c916dfc90b49157bcbf032d844487fa445fa367dabfae0a5efcb99f8bfde13
confirmations
214905
spent
true